Informational Influence
The effect that the knowledge, opinions, or behaviors of others can have on one’s own responses, often leading to conformity due to the desire to be correct.
Expert Power
Expert Power is the ability to influence others' attitudes or behaviors based on the perception of one's knowledge, expertise, or experience in a specific area.
Information Power
The influence or control over others that is gained through access to or possession of information.
Marketing Power
The ability of a company or brand to influence the buying behavior of consumers, shaping perceptions and driving demand for its products or services.
